I think LSU is a prime example to show that's just not gonna cut it. LSU has had classes that range from #2- #12 since Saban took over at Bama yet they've only beat them twice . Saban has had a top 5 class every year since 2009. If UGA keeps recruiting the way they are and we recruit like your saying then were in major major trouble. In order to keep up we have to recruit mostly top 5 classes it's that simple. Bama and UGA are gonna get theirs that seems pretty clear so we have to keep up or we will fall to far behind. I think that's already the case but a top 5 class would help.

Sure, it's going to be hard to beat a team that has 30-40 more blue-chips than you do....and the one's they do have are ranked in the top 100, 200 while most your ours are ranked 200-400.

LSU has had some sh*tty and questionable coaching over the last 8-10 years. Miles went through several OC's and hasn't had a servicable QB in years (much like UF's problems: bad coaching and bad QB play).

I agree w/ you though. It's an uphill battle right now. As I said before, the stench is still fresh on the UF "brand" and it might take a couple of years for Mullen to right the ship.
